Summary of Channel: Lamp Per Channel Menu

• Lamp Power: Enabled only when LiteLOC™ is disabled. Lamp Power indicates what per centage of
power to supply to the lamp, automatically overriding any LiteLOC™ setting that may be in effect. This
causes the bar graph to rise or fall as Lamp Power is increased or decreased, but the LiteLOC™ red line and
Set values will not change unless Set is pressed (defining a new LiteLOC™ setting and enabling LiteLOC™
checkbox). Lamp Power range = 50% - 100% (1000-2100W) 
representing the percentage of the lamp's power rating.
• Enable: Enter a checkmark to enable LiteLOC™ for the current channel based on the value in the Set light
level window.
• Set (Brightness): Automatically enables LiteLOC™ and maintains the current brightness level as long as
possible. Arbitrary units-of-measure shown in the Set light level window, not lumens or fL.
• Light: This is a meter reading from the projector's light sensor, which indicates the current light output
(vertical bar) and LiteLOC™ level set (red horizontal line). The value at the top of the meter is shown in
arbitrary units-of-measure and does not represent actual lumens or fL.
• Lamp (Read Only): Indicates the current lamp age (hours), amps (amps), voltage (volts), footlamberts (fL)
and watts (lamp power).

Channel: Lens Menu

This menu is for advanced users only and is used to modify the ILS settings for a particular channel. Once the
ILS settings are changed a Pending status message appears on screen until the changes have been applied.
To adjust ILS settings for a particular channel:
1. Select a channel from the drop-down list.
2. Use the designated icon keys to adjust Focus, XY offset and Zoom.
3. Press Activate to save the settings to the particular channel. To easily copy settings from one channel to
another use the Copy Lens Settings to Channel... feature. Simply select the channel from the drop-down
list and click Copy to apply the changes.
